Ted Nelson Vortrag Ted Nelson - ZigZag

herbert.katzlinger.uni-linz, 10. Oktober 2011, 06:27

Einige technikbezogene Anmerkungen zum Vortrag von Ted Nelson betreffend "ZigZag".

Der Vortrag bzw. die visualisierte Darstellung in Form einer kurzen Demonstration der grundsätzlichen Arbeitweise des Systems ließ aus technischer Perspektive bedeutende und für die Machbarkeit , Umsetzbarkeit und Praxisrelevanz bedeutende Informationen vermissen:

a) Persistenz, Datenbanksystem, Datenmodell und Strukturen:

Welches Datenbanksystem (Relationales, Objektorientiertes, Hierarchiches, Netzwerkmodell, Mischformen)  wurden eingesetzt und wie sieht das Datenmodell, sofern vorhanden,  aus ?

Wie wurde die Datenhaltung bzw. Peristierung tatsächlich gestaltet ?

Wie sieht  das Interface zwischen der  (dynamischen) Repräsentation dieser persistenten Daten , der Be- ,  bzw. Verarbeitung und Abbildung im Hauptspeicher auf Datenstrukturen und Algorithmen und der Visualisierung zur Laufzeit  aus?

Wurde eventuell auf neuere Konzepte/Modelle wie sie beispielsweise unter dem  Begriff "NoSql" 

 subsummiert werden, zurückgegriffen ?

b) Welche Algorithmen und Datenstrukturen (ausser den erwähnten sogenannten "Listen") kommen zum Einsatz ?

Da sich die Algorithmen und Datenstrukturen häufig sehr wesentlich hinsichtlich Ressourcenbedarf, Verarbeitungsgeschwindigkeit und Aufwand betreffend unterschiedlicher Operationen wie Suchen, Sorten, Verändern, Einfügen, Löschen usw. unterscheiden, wurde eine Anfrage beim Vortragenden gestellt, ob es sich bei den genannten "Listen" um eine sogenannte "SkipList"  handelt, was bejaht wurde. 

d) Datenvolumen und Verarbeitung:

Es stellt sich auch die Frage, wie sich das System bei grossen Datenmengen hinsichtlich Softwarequalitätskriterien wie Performance (vor allem Laufzeit, Antwortzeit usw.), Speicherverbrauch,  Stabilität usw. verhält.

e) Weiters ist zu hinterfragen, welche Gründe relevant sein könnten, warum der reale (wirtschaftliche) Einsatz und die Anwendung in der wirtschaftlichen Praxis in entsprechendem Umfang und Ausmaß bislang nicht gegeben ist, sofern das überhaupt als estrebenswertes Ziel war und ist.

0 comments :: Kommentieren